Breaking Down the Features of SureFire 3 Prong Wrench, Black, Z-71347
Specifications
The SureFire 3 Prong Wrench, Black, Z-71347 is a specialized tool designed for installing and removing SureFire SOCOM series 3-prong flash hiders and WARCOMPS. It is constructed from 304 stainless steel for exceptional durability and corrosion resistance. The wrench is compatible with all SOCOM 5.56, 6.8, and 7.62 3-Prong Flash Hiders and WARCOMPS. It features a 1/2-inch drive interface for use with standard ratchets or torque wrenches.
These specifications matter because they ensure compatibility, durability, and ease of use. The stainless steel construction guarantees that the wrench will withstand the rigors of repeated use and exposure to harsh environments. The compatibility with all SOCOM series flash hiders eliminates any guesswork, while the 1/2-inch drive interface allows for precise torque control, preventing over-tightening or under-tightening of the flash hider.
